Our Brucejack Gold Mine, a high-grade underground mine in beautiful northern British Columbia, is located approximately 65 kilometres north of Stewart. Brucejack is a fly-in/fly-out operation with pick-up points across Western Canada, making it easy for people from different places to join us. We work closely with local First Nations communities including the Nisga’a, Tahltan, Gitanyow, and Gitxsan, to build respectful partnerships and celebrate our shared community

Brucejack is one of the highest-grade gold mines in the world – a remote underground operation famously located on top of a glacier in northwestern British Columbia. With a fly-in, fly-out roster and on-site camp, our team works in a truly unique environment, using modern mining methods to safely extract gold and silver from deep beneath the ice. Role Purpose
Support employee health, recovery, and workplace wellness by managing disability and return-to-work (RTW) programs. Partner with employees, leaders, healthcare providers, and external stakeholders to facilitate safe, sustainable RTW outcomes, workplace accommodations, and injury prevention initiatives.
Key Roles and Responsibilities
- Manage occupational disability cases from injury/illness through successful return to work.
- Develop and monitor individualized RTW and accommodation plans.
- Collaborate with employees, leaders, HR, Health Services, insurers, WCB, and healthcare providers to support recovery and workplace reintegration.
- Provide guidance on disability management, fitness-for-work, medical restrictions, and workplace accommodations.
- Conduct ergonomic assessments and recommend solutions to reduce injury risk and improve workplace safety.
- Support occupational health, injury prevention, wellness, and health monitoring programs.
- Maintain accurate case documentation and ensure compliance with privacy, workers’ compensation, and regulatory requirements.
- Deliver education and training on early intervention, RTW, and accommodation best practices.
Required Skills, Knowledge, and Experience
- Bachelor’s degree in Physiotherapy, Occupational Therapy, Kinesiology, Rehabilitation Science, Disability Management, or a related health discipline.
- Current professional registration, where applicable.
- Experience in disability management, return-to-work coordination, workplace accommodations, and occupational health.
- Knowledge of workers’ compensation processes, fitness-for-work assessments, ergonomic principles, and relevant legislation.
- Strong case management, stakeholder engagement, communication, and problem-solving skills.
- Valid Class 5 driver’s licence.
- Occupational First Aid Level 3 (OFA3) certification, or willingness to obtain upon hire.
- Preferred: CDMP, CRTWC, NIDMAR training, FAE certification, ergonomic assessment training, and Mental Health First Aid.
